Picking an Mediator: The American Mediation Association Process
When engaging in arbitration, carefully selecting the right arbitrator is vital. The U.S. Mediation Body (AAA) furnishes a structured procedure for this important task. Typically, the AAA’s roster includes individuals with specialization in diverse industries. Parties can initially review arbitrator records on the AAA’s website, evaluating factors such as history, qualifications, and fees. The choice commonly involves a chain of phases: submitting a list of desirable candidates, enabling the other party to review and challenge those nominations, and then, if needed, using a inventory of readily-available mediators to reach a agreed-upon determination. Finally, the AAA’s framework helps parties in acquiring an neutral third-party professional to settle their argument.

American Arbitration Association: Costs and Considerations
Navigating this nation's Arbitration Association can involve significant fees , and understanding these considerations is crucial before starting the dispute . Usually , charges cover filing charges, adjudicator daily fees, witness costs, and processing charges. The amounts differ substantially relative to case's scope and duration your mediation . In addition, claimants need to assess likely awards and if mediation is the economical alternative to a lawsuit.
